Rosen Zhelyazkov with sincere support for Republic of North Macedonia

The Speaker of the National Assembly, Rosen Zhelyazkov, will again today in Skopje demonstrate the categorical desire of the official Sofia Republic of Macedonia not to waste time and to start negotiations for membership in the European Union as soon as possible. Zhelyazkov is the only Bulgarian politician from the top state leadership of the country who consistently makes efforts to speed up the European process of our southwestern neighbor. This will be Zhelyazkov's third meeting with his colleague Talat Xhaferi in the last five months.

The Speaker of the Bulgarian Parliament will visit the Republic of North Macedonia at the invitation of the Speaker of the Parliament of the Republic of North Macedonia, Talat Xhaferi, reported the special envoy of BGNES in Skopje, Georgi Pashkulev.

The first meeting took place in the Italian capital Rome, where the delegations of Bulgaria and Republic of North Macedonia, led respectively by the Speakers of the Parliaments Rosen Zhelyazkov and Talat Xhaferi, bowed before the relics and work of the Holy Brothers Cyril and Methodius. On May 25, they jointly laid wreaths in front of the Bulgarian and Macedonian plaques in the Basilica of Santa Maria Maggiore, in which Slavic books were officially recognized by Pope Adrian II. Then Rosen Zhelyazkov called on the RSM not to waste time, but to fulfill the membership criteria.

"Bulgaria believes that the RSM will be a full member of the EU based on its own contribution. We believe that they will fulfill the conditions for membership and they should not waste time, because the worst thing is to waste time, which will turn into skepticism", the chairman of the 49th National Assembly warned at the time and added that in Skopje they should take quick decisive acts and definite decisions without looking for the cause outside themselves.

The second meeting took place a month later. On June 30, Zhelyazkov and Jaffery took part in the Global Conference to mark the International Day of Parliamentarianism in the Spanish city of Leon. Zhelyazkov noted that Bulgaria's position on Skopje's accession to the EU is consistent. Guaranteeing the rights of Bulgarians in the Republic of North Macedonia by including them in the country's Constitution is the key to the development of good neighborly relations between the two countries, he added.

The Speaker of the Bulgarian Parliament emphasized that other countries cannot solve our problems. According to him, the change of tone is of particular importance. We must pay attention to how the two countries present their neighbor in the information space, noted Zhelyazkov.

The program of today's visit of the Speaker of the Bulgarian Parliament, in addition to the meeting with Talat Xhaferi, also includes a pilgrimage to the sarcophagus of Gotse Delchev in the Church of the Holy Saviour, an event at the Bulgarian Cultural and Information Center in Skopje, at which vouchers for internet training will be distributed to children with disabilities, their parents and teachers, as well as the opening of the exhibition "Silver Thrace" in the Archaeological Museum of Republic of North Macedonia.
